Output d2138821ce10d17231aa3d795e88f5dbaa7d4a014e4e7e534cc3501cf422ee92:0

value
504754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82eeaa697d2efd8201d6fc27051822ed26df730a OP_EQUAL
address
3DdKgGE5KWA8hASEruNw9ACpp8aco1WR7G
transaction
d2138821ce10d17231aa3d795e88f5dbaa7d4a014e4e7e534cc3501cf422ee92
spent
true